Wiki Comparison

Open Source Classroom has an excellent in-depth examination of most of the main wiki options that I’ve seen in quite some time. The requirements are a little different from most (collaboration amongst 10 and 11 year old school children), but the differences aren’t really that different. It’s not just children who don’t want to learn complex wiki markup, and many companies wouldn’t really want uncontrollable Google ads throughout their site either.

Mediawiki, Pbwiki, Jotspot, Wikispaces, Dokuwiki, Netcipia, Editme, and Wetpaint are all considered, and all come up short. You can read the review yourself to see why, and discover which one was eventually chosen.
